Chicago's older neighborhoods accumulate grime in a particular way — exhaust particulate, algae, and years of foot traffic pressing dirt into every porous surface until stone walkways read more gray than their original color. This property came to us carrying exactly that kind of buildup, the kind that doesn't respond to water pressure alone and signals from the first pass that the job will need a more deliberate approach.
Our crew assessed the surface before committing to a method. The stone walkways were heavily soiled — deeply enough that we brought in a chemical treatment to break the contamination down before the pressure rinse could do its work. Applying the solution and letting it dwell, then working through the surface in controlled passes, drew out the embedded grime that a straight pressure wash would have pushed around rather than removed. The combination of chemistry and equipment produced a consistent result across the full area. Invoice went out once the walkways had dried and the crew had cleared the site.

Common questions from Chicago homeowners researching Power Washing.
Walkway and exterior power washing in Chicago typically runs between $150 and $400 depending on square footage and how heavily soiled the surfaces are. Jobs with heavy buildup—like this one, which required specialty cleaning chemicals to cut through deep-set grime—can land toward the higher end of that range. Surface type, accessibility, and total area are the biggest pricing factors.
For a standard residential walkway, most jobs wrap up in one to three hours depending on total square footage and surface condition. This particular project ran longer than average because the walkways were heavily soiled and required pre-treatment with special chemicals before pressure could do its job effectively.
When we wash walkways, we cover the full surface area from edge to edge, including any joints, borders, and transition points where dirt and organic buildup tend to concentrate. On heavily soiled surfaces like this job, that also means applying appropriate cleaning agents before washing to ensure the grime actually lifts rather than just getting pushed around.
We use professional-grade cleaning solutions when plain water pressure isn't enough to remove stubborn dirt, algae, or staining—this walkway job is a good example where chemicals were necessary to get a thorough clean. The solutions we use are selected for the specific surface being washed and are applied carefully to protect surrounding landscaping and materials.
